Jh. Hofmeyr et Bv. Burger, CONTROLLED-RELEASE PHEROMONE DISPENSER FOR USE IN TRAPS TO MONITOR FLIGHT ACTIVITY OF FALSE CODLING MOTH, Journal of chemical ecology, 21(3), 1995, pp. 355-363
Field trials were conducted in the western Cape Province, South Africa
, to develop a sex pheromone dispenser suitable for monitoring the fig
ht activity of false codling moth. A controlled-release dispenser capa
ble of releasing sex pheromone at a predetermined and constant release
rate without replacement for more than seven months was produced.
